I used these restore DVDs to perform a clean upgrade of my Kronos X to Kronos 2. Of course I needed to buy the new Kronos sound pack to authorize the new EXis, and perform the upgrade to latest OS.
I tried to download the restore DVDs for KX from Korg website but it was not usable because the zip file is corrupted.
I'm a big fan of clean installations, very often the result is a more stable machine.
